Israel shows mobility sector how to nurture new talent

Plenty of mobility innovation is coming out of the 'start-up nation', but not much is deploying there. Megan Lampinen takes a closer look at the situation

Israel has established itself as a hot bed of entrepreneurial activity around intelligent mobility and cyber security. The country has produced a long list of trailblazing start-ups like Mobileye, Waze, Gett and Drive.ai, all of which have gone on to make global waves in the automotive industry. The book Start-up Nation, published in 2009, explored the wider environmental factors that fostered such innovation over the years. Active nurturing of new talent remains a key focus in the country today.
